How do I unblock YouTube on school Chrome?
- Navigate to Apps > Additional Google services.
- Scroll down to YouTube.
- Click on Permissions and select the OU you would like to change permissions for.
- Set the level of permission for this OU.
- Click on ‘Save’, this may take up to 24 hours to change.

How do I turn off restricted mode on YouTube on a school computer?
How to turn off Restricted Mode on YouTube on a computer
- Go to youtube.com and click on your profile icon, located in the top-right corner of the screen.
- Scroll to the bottom of that menu and click “Restricted Mode: On.”
- Toggle the “Activate Restricted Mode” option off (it will go from blue to grey).
